1. What Are Cookies?
Cookies are small text files placed on your device when you visit a website. They help websites function efficiently, recognize returning visitors, and gather analytics to improve user experience.
Cookies may be:
- Session cookies — deleted automatically when you close your browser.
- Persistent cookies — stored on your device until they expire or are manually deleted.
- First-party cookies — set directly by our website.
- Third-party cookies — set by services integrated into our site (e.g., analytics or social media platforms).
